mongodb数据库如何备份 mongodb 定时备份

导读:在使用mongodb数据库时,为了保证数据的安全性和可靠性,我们需要对数据库进行备份 。而定时备份是一种比较常见的备份方式,本文将介绍mongodb定时备份的方法和注意事项 。
1. 确定备份时间
首先,我们需要确定备份的时间 。根据业务需求和数据变化情况,可以选择每天、每周或每月进行备份 。同时,还需要考虑备份时长和备份文件大小等因素 。
2. 编写备份脚本
接下来,我们需要编写备份脚本 。可以使用mongodump命令来备份mongodb数据库 。例如,使用以下命令备份名为test的数据库:
【mongodb数据库如何备份 mongodb 定时备份】mongodump --db test --out /data/backup/test
3. 设置定时任务
为了实现定时备份,我们可以使用Linux系统中的crontab命令来设置定时任务 。例如,在每天凌晨3点备份test数据库,可以使用以下命令:
0 3 * * * mongodump --db test --out /data/backup/test
4. 备份文件存储
备份完成后 , 需要将备份文件存储到安全可靠的位置 。可以将备份文件上传至云存储或其他网络硬盘,也可以将备份文件存储在本地服务器上 。
总结:定时备份是mongodb数据库备份的一种常见方式,通过设置定时任务和编写备份脚本,可以实现自动化备份 。同时,备份文件的存储也需要考虑到安全可靠性等因素 。

    推荐阅读